Dmitri Shostakovich in Russia - 1939

from Dmitry Shostakovich-About Himself and His Times, page 83:

After the Fifth Symphony, I turned once more to the cinema and wrote the music for the film The Man with a Gun, produced by Sergei Yutkevich. / After this I wrote my First String Quartet. I began it with no particular thoughts or feelings, and thought that nothing would come of it. For the quartet is one of the most difficult musical genres. But soon the work took a proper hold of me.
